Output 2189897690b431daaa14ecbeef89c78a9b05afb4f1d59c5705f692d156cd088d:0

value
1270014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fc9c4bd6a2fb71e8a940e58588c98cc47782ce9 OP_EQUAL
address
38xu1pYeEqhBd8zidxz3tnszFw4z7YgE4G
transaction
2189897690b431daaa14ecbeef89c78a9b05afb4f1d59c5705f692d156cd088d
confirmations
177379
spent
true